static int on_timer_wakeup(struct state *state)
|
|
{
|
|
snd_pcm_sframes_t avail, delay;
|
|
double error, corr;
|
|
|
|
/* check the delay in the device */
|
|
CHECK(snd_pcm_avail_delay(state->hndl, &avail, &delay), "delay");
|
|
|
|
/* calculate the error, we want to have exactly 1 period of
|
|
* samples remaining in the device when we wakeup. */
|
|
error = (double)delay - (double)state->period;
|
|
|
|
/* update the dll with the error, this gives a rate correction */
|
|
corr = spa_dll_update(&state->dll, error);
|
|
|
|
/* set our new adjusted timeout. alternatively, this value can
|
|
* instead be used to drive a resampler if this device is
|
|
* slaved. */
|
|
state->next_time += state->period / corr * 1e9 / state->rate;
|
|
set_timeout(state, state->next_time);
|
|
|
|
if (state->next_time - state->prev_time > BW_PERIOD) {
|
|
state->prev_time = state->next_time;
|
|
|
|
/* reduce bandwidth and show some stats */
|
|
if (state->dll.bw > SPA_DLL_BW_MIN)
|
|
spa_dll_set_bw(&state->dll, state->dll.bw / 2.0,
|
|
state->period, state->rate);
|
|
|
|
fprintf(stdout, "corr:%f error:%f bw:%f\n",
|
|
corr, error, state->dll.bw);
|
|
}
|
|
/* pull in new samples write a new period */
|
|
write_period(state);
|
|
|
|
return 0;
|
|
}
